PayPal appoints Geoff Seeley as CMO

PayPal has named Geoff Seeley as its new Chief Marketing Officer.

Seeley brings over 25 years of global brand, digital, and performance experience having recently held the position of CMO and Communications Officer at CashApp and Afterpay.

Before this, he also held senior marketing positions at Airbnb, Unilever, Pearsons and Ogilvy.

Meanwhile, in his new position, Seeley will be responsible for overseeing the Global Marketing team across PayPal’s brand portfolio, including Venmo, ensuring the brand’s value propositions are clear, compelling, and simple for customers.

He will also report to Diego Scotti, Executive Vice President (EVP) and General Manager (GM) of Consumer Group and Global Marketing & Communications.

Scotti said: “Geoff has a rich and impressive background leading marketing teams and building brands across some of the biggest global companies.

“Geoff brings over 25 years of expertise in transforming global consumer and B2B brands by leveraging cutting-edge digital and performance marketing and building strong teams focused on enhancing brand awareness and engagement with customers.”
